Edison Standard Model B with 2/4 minute gearing, Model C reproducer, and original early “PAT APL’D FOR” 14” horn.
Model C reproducer completely serviced. New gaskets, sapphire rotated to new facet. Plays gloriously. Motor is oiled, lubricated, and has NEW MAINSPRING INSTALLED, and new leather belt. This is the machine I have been testing my Recorders on. Very steady with no gear flutter. With a Model H reproducer (not included) it plays smooth as silk.
“Edison” signature on front of cabinet is somewhat weak. Wood overall very good. Old refinish looks surprisingly nice.
